Abigail Jaquith 1742–1765 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 28 May 1742

Birth Location: Billerica, Middlesex, Massachusetts, United States

Death Date: 4 Sep 1765

Death Location: Wilton, Hillsborough, New Hampshire, USA

Father: Abraham Jaquith

Mother: Hannah Farley

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1742, Abigail Jaquith entered the world in Billerica, Middlesex, Massachusetts, United States, born to Abraham Jaquith And Hannah Farley. Abigail Jaquith passed away in 1765 in Wilton, Hillsborough, New Hampshire, USA.
